NAVTEQ True represents a new era in data collection, utilizing technologies unique in the industry in both the scale and quality with which collection of the NAVTEQ map and content can take place. The technology is comprised of best in class technologies in four sensor systems: Positioning, Panoramic Cameras, High Resolution Cameras and Rotating LIDAR.

APIs for Building Desktop Applications
NAVTEQ offers powerful APIs that support the seamless integration of mapping functionality into software applications.
NAVTEQ APIs for Building Desktop Applications can be used to integrate geospatial components into customer solutions such as ERP, CPM, Workforce Management, Call Center, Fleet Management, and many more.
These are the provided APIs for building desktop applications:
- MapTP Component Interface (Active X, DLL for Windows)
- MapTP API for the Java Platform
- MapTP C++ API
The MapTP API for the Java Platform and the MapTP C++ API offer the same functionality so that developers can choose the programming language based on their preference or project requirements. The MapTP Component Interface offers a lightweight programming interface on top of the MapTP API.
You can expect to find documentation, samples, demos, and training materials for building desktop applications with the MapTP APIs.
